Bishop on the ball with Gaza’s Christian community

admin January 14, 2016
Bishop Oscar Cantu of Las Cruces, New Mexico, plays soccer with boys while visiting Gaza City. The bishop was part of a delegation from North America, Europe and South Africa (Photo: CNS).
